REED v. FAIRMONT CREAMERY CO.

No. 8591.

37 F.2d 332 (1929)

REED v. FAIRMONT CREAMERY CO.

Circuit Court of Appeals, Eighth Circuit.

December 31, 1929.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

W. C. Fraser, of Minneapolis, Minn. (Albert G. Craig, of Denver, Colo., and George L. Schein, of Chicago, Ill., on the brief), for appellant.

Leonard A. Flansburg, of Lincoln, Neb. (George A. Lee, of Lincoln, Neb., M. S. Hartman, of Omaha, Neb., and John O. Sheldahl, of Lincoln, Neb., on the brief), for appellee.

Before VAN VALKENBURGH and GARDNER, Circuit Judges, and MUNGER, District Judge.


MUNGER, District Judge.

This appeal seeks to reverse a decree sustaining the appellee's motion to dismiss the appellant's bill of complaint. The motion alleged that no cause of action was stated in the bill, and that the bill showed plaintiff's claim to be barred by the statute of limitations and by the plaintiff's laches.
